Transaction 489431875a03309e52287994a369baaf38630b8fb2ab65de87fd8165f6512756
1 Input
1 Output
-
489431875a03309e52287994a369baaf38630b8fb2ab65de87fd8165f6512756:0
- value
- 1458000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 579706427ecbaf83fe9ce060c9a4a696d2cbdfc9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18z8i42QYEKv4xBGWv7dJCA8nin5RBe3fT